SNOW ON EAST COAST.
(By Telegraph.—Own Correspondent.)
OPOTTKI, Thursday
Travellers from Gieborne experienced a very cold trip this morning, six inches of snow having fallen last night. Snow fell nearly as far dowu as Trafford'e Hill.
